What does it mean to be the treasurer of a club?

Treasurer often Serve as club financial advisor, including setting a club budget. … The Treasurer is responsible for collecting all funds due to the club and keeping records of membership dues and dues unless these responsibilities are delegated to the secretary.

What is expected of the Treasurer?

Treasurer can Manage or supervise the management of the organization’s finances, which typically includes basic tasks such as selecting a bank, reconciling bank statements, and managing cash flow. In some organizations, the treasurer may also be responsible for investing funds in accordance with applicable law.

What are the duties of the club secretary?

secretary general Responsible for the administration of the club, scheduling meetings (and recording and distributing minutes for those meetings) and dealing with any administration regarding the club’s constitution. All correspondence is normally handled by the secretary.

What does a treasurer do at school?

a school treasurer Handling the financial activities of a school district or similar agency. They often serve on school boards and are responsible for maintaining financial and accounting records. Job responsibilities also include executing budgets and tracking receipts.

Is Treasurer a Leadership Position?

Key leadership positions are President, Vice President, Secretary and Treasurer. The officers of the club and chairs of various activities and committees typically form the board of directors, which sets policy and provides general direction for all club activities.
